Cultural Note
Portuguese and most Brazilian cuisine is not traditionally spicy, but Bahian food is the major exception, using malagueta peppers and pimenta-de-cheiro extensively due to African and indigenous influences. In the rest of Brazil, 'pimenta' (hot pepper sauce) is offered as a condiment, not cooked into the food. Portuguese food rarely features heat.
📝 Example Sentences
A comida baiana é muito picante.
Bahian food is very spicy.
Você gosta de comida picante?
Do you like spicy food?
Ponha um pouco de molho picante, por favor.
Put a little hot sauce, please.
